Short Film Shot In Long Valley Premieres This Fall
Earlier this summer, a movie called "The Mailbox" spent time filming in Long Valley.
LONG VALLEY, NJ — Earlier this summer, film crews transformed parts of Long Valley into a movie set complete with lights and cameras in preparation for filming for a new short film.
In early June, the production company Innerscope Studio came to Long Valley to film their new film, "The Mailbox." The trailer for the short film was released this week, along with the release date of fall 2023.
"We are excited to welcome the cast and crew of these films to Long Valley and to showcase our town's unique charm and character to a wider audience," Innerscope Studio said.

"The Mailbox" follows two characters, Monica and Alice, who are from different eras and find a connection through a unique and magical mailbox, according to officials.
Giuliana Sciortino, Giovanna Cirmi, and Emma Jaupi are listed as the main actors in the film.

Innerscope Studio is a video production company that provides on-demand video production services ranging from concept to completion. Furthermore, the studio is also working on the film "Death of Humanity," which is in pre-production. The film was written and directed by Kim Kavin, a Long Valley resident.
"We are excited about the opportunity to showcase Long Valley's beautiful landscapes, historic buildings, and unique characters in these films. The films will also provide a boost to our local economy by bringing in revenue from the film industry," Innerscope Studio said.
